IN RE BARTLETT

No. 1076.

108 Ohio App. 93 (1958)

IN RE BARTLETT.

Court of Appeals of Ohio, Marion County.

Decided April 16, 1958.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Mr. John W. Yager, for appellant Kelsey Bartlett.

Mr. Robert O. Stout, prosecuting attorney, for appellee.


MIDDLETON, P. J.

This is an appeal from a judgment of the Probate Court denying the motion of appellant to vacate its former judgment finding the appellant to be mentally ill and its order of commitment to a mental hospital made pursuant to that judgment,
